0、安装 node.jscss
一、建立一个react-app
建议采用官网方式:https://reactjs.org/docs/crea...html
npx create-react-app my-app cd my-app npm start
二、暴露webpacknode
npm run eject
三、下载 LESS 或者 SASS (采用下面一种方式便可)react
npm install less-loader less --save-dev // 下载LESS npm install sass-loader node-sass --save-dev // 下载SASS
四、配置config文件下的 webpack.config.dev.js 及 webpack.config.prod.js ,两格文件修改的是同样的地方,故只展现一个文件
图一是配置LESS的,只修改红色框框处webpack
// 修改前 test: /\.css$/, // 修改后代码 test: /\.css|less$/, // 在该处新添加 { loader: require.resolve('less-loader') },
图二是配置SASS的,只修改红色框框处,修改方式与LESS相同web
// 修改前 test: /\.css$/, // 修改后代码 test: /\.css|scss$/, // 在该处新添加 { loader: require.resolve('sass-loader') },
五、最后添加.less文件 或 .scss文件就能够运行了。npm